As some issues lately discussed on both lists evidently show, there is not to much attention paid to REAL PURITY of all, or at lest some linux config files, in particular axports file.
It is CRUCIAL, that axports file: - CAN NOT contain ANY EMPTY line at all! If additional space is necessary between lines then usual spaceholder "#" is fine, - CAN NOT contain ^M (CR - in hex 0x0D) code at the end of any line!
NOT RESPECTING above two rules may result in unpredictable behavior of many AMPRNet software, not to mention FBB BBS, URONode.
Presence of ^M (CR) code can be viewed and corrected, for instance, in Midnight Commander, VI and well known Emacs editors.
From the other hand, simple and friendly editors
like nano and joe, apparently are useless...
There are few nifty tools that may one use for removing ^M characters, even from bunch of files without editing. Best known is dos2unix available for all linux like distros.

Being a ^M "offender" I can tell you that the ax.25 and Uronode and axMailFax software have no issues with said ^M characters in the axports file. The blank line issue has been well known for years but to my recollection, only for NetROM's nrports file. I (until yesterday) had a blank end line on my axports file to no detriment.
